Pre-Installation Planning and Assessment
Before a single camera is unpacked, a thorough assessment of the site is critical. You must identify the primary objectives, such as monitoring entry points, parking lots, or interior corridors, as this dictates the camera type and quantity required. Evaluate the environmental conditions, including lighting, weather exposure, and potential obstructions, to select appropriate housings and lenses. Furthermore, verify network infrastructure readiness, ensuring sufficient bandwidth and available switch ports to handle the video streams without compromising existing IT operations.
Physical Installation and Camera Mounting
The physical installation process requires precision to achieve the desired field of view and durability. For outdoor deployments, use heavy-duty mounts and ensure proper weather sealing to protect against dust and moisture. Indoors, choose locations that minimize interference and physical tampering. Always confirm the power source is stable and, for PoE (Power over Ethernet) setups, verify that the switch or injector supports the required IEEE standard. Network Configuration and Connectivity
Once mounted, network configuration is essential for seamless integration. Assign static IP addresses or configure DHCP reservations to ensure consistent access to each device. Adjust the RTSP stream settings to match the bandwidth capabilities of your network, balancing resolution and frame rate against available throughput. For remote viewing, configure port forwarding or, preferably, use Hikvision’s proprietary DDNS or P2P connection methods to simplify access without compromising security protocols.
Software Integration and Management Setup
With the hardware connected, the next phase involves software integration through the SmartPSS management suite or mobile applications. During the setup, update the firmware to the latest stable version to patch vulnerabilities and improve codec efficiency. Create user accounts with granular permissions, ensuring that operators have access only to the cameras and functions necessary for their role. Configure recording schedules and storage paths, either on local NVRs or cloud solutions, based on your retention policies and data sensitivity.
Testing, Calibration, and Optimization
After initial setup, comprehensive testing is non-negotiable. Verify video feed quality in real-world conditions, checking for clarity, color accuracy, and low-light performance. Adjust backlight compensation, wide dynamic range (WDR), and digital noise reduction settings to suit the environment. Test motion detection zones and alert thresholds to minimize false triggers. This calibration phase ensures that the system performs reliably, day and night, without excessive bandwidth consumption.
Ongoing Maintenance and Security Practices
Installation is not a one-time event; ongoing maintenance is vital for sustained performance. Regularly inspect cameras for physical damage, clean lenses, and verify that firmware updates are applied promptly. Monitor system logs for unusual login attempts or network anomalies, and change default credentials immediately. Implement strong password policies and enable encryption protocols to protect video data from unauthorized access, ensuring the system remains secure against evolving cyber threats.
